SB650 by Hegar (Relating to management of certain metropolitan rapid transit authorities.), Committee Report 1st House, Substituted

No significant fiscal implication to the State is anticipated.

The bill would amend the Transportation Code to implement recommendations from the Sunset Commission for the Capital Metropolitan Transportation Authority (Capital Metro). The bill would require the Capital Metro board to annually adopt a five-year capital plan; and adopt and annually reevaluate a strategic plan.
 
The bill also would require the board to maintain a reserve equal to at least two months of operating expenses at the beginning of the fiscal year to be established not later than September 1, 2016. The board would be required to adopt a comprehensive rail safety plan that would be implemented by the general manager; and to regularly report on rail system safety to the Texas Department of Transportation. Capital Metro would be required to competitively bid and purchase all transit services not directly provided by its own employees.
 
Capital Metro would be authorized to issue bonds at any time for any amounts it considers necessary or appropriate for managing or funding self-insurance or for retirement or pension fund reserves for pension plans existing as of January 1, 2011.

Local Government Impact

According to the Sunset Commission, the only section of the bill expected to have a significant fiscal impact is the requirement of competitive bidding. Based on estimates, Capital Metro could experience a net savings of $11,800,000 in fiscal year (FY) 2013; $16,200,000 in FY 2014­–15; and $22,200,000 in FY 2016. Capital Metro would need to add three full-time employees for FY 2012 and seven full-time employees for FY 2013–16.
